@webwriter/network
Version:
Visualization of network topologies. Can represent different kinds of networks.
236 lines (229 loc) • 12.4 kB
text/typescript
// Do not modify this file by hand!
// Re-generate this file by running lit-localize
/* eslint-disable no-irregular-whitespace */
/* eslint-disable @typescript-eslint/no-explicit-any */
export const templates = {
's480e8cca00501fbf': `Octets shouldn't be of negative value`,
's186f0d4339ae84fd': `Repeater`,
's8545094bc2096970': `Bridge`,
's1018d5f2b1cc4e8d': `Access Point`,
'sf56b78a9e5b4640f': `The netmask you entered`,
'sb3c6effefba5ccb8': `doesn't match the bitmask`,
's0a7748b8de0b3a6f': `Derived netmask is`,
's2f034d5e354fd8fe': `Provided network ID is not valid.`,
's4860102f9ca44d7b': `Net-based Mode for CIDR/Subnetting activated:`,
'scfc539cb2204d99f': `Cannot create a net without both bitmask and netmask!`,
'saf114a45c687be19': `Hosts-based mode:`,
'se60f6f327c8094af': `No valid network address can be assigned to this net.`,
's6b05f9d8801fc14f': `Host`,
's3741f219c32abe78': `Net`,
'sc2abe27bb5be2879': `Gateway`,
'sc096fbcee1f2951a': `should contain`,
's8d70ca4af5a9c009': `with address`,
's9feb1a1345ccc3e5': `Network`,
's33aec365752c45d7': `The netmask you entered`,
's95b91fa7ce0e4422': `Your changes have been saved.`,
'sbee40693bf2c18e9': `Host-based mode on:`,
'sb6ee4842d085bac3': `New network doesn't extend old network!`,
's47abed60b53d9f15': `The connection type of assigned ports are not compatible!`,
's6e488f7a11e566e4': `Please re-assign your ports or dismiss this connection.`,
's0f527a17b9b690e2': `Well done!`,
's431446cf4939d374': `All nets are correctly configured!`,
's8ec5e5061ca83fb9': `Unconfigured net still exists.`,
's330a19f706948b7c': `Cross validation between Nets: `,
's3b07747d0bd1c988': `Setting up gateway: `,
's6881b5a560c88bf8': `Net-based mode on:`,
'sa9b946da3254eeb2': `Unconfigured net, automatically set Ipv4 address to loop-back.`,
'sfa2e7dafd99371ff': `Port number`,
'sc1b1fc103ff1b1b3': `Interface name`,
'sb7233970916468e3': `Connection type`,
's44646f1a480a4a28': `MAC Address`,
'scbbde46d3e773c0e': `Ethernet`,
's05f14bdb78dbcdb1': `Wireless`,
's7a1405870058921f': `Assigning ports for this connection`,
'se2cc791794723812': `Select one from available ports:`,
'se29a5823185d420c': `Please choose port/interface for`,
's0771257848b4d7a3': `Details about component`,
'sb4f8acbdda6ff3b9': `Details of the ports`,
's5804ccf243041e60': `is not a valid MAC Address.`,
'sb781a2ba64e70be8': `Subnet-based mode on:`,
'sdb11e8f269ea1b13': `Inserted IPv4 doesn't match the subnet mask.`,
's138df1ceb51a3661': `Inserted IPv4 for gateway doesn't match the subnet mask or the network is not configured.`,
's213a3bbc3f7af684': `is not valid.`,
'sed931f57adaad8c0': `is not a valid IPv6 Address.`,
's3f015779aaa1979d': `Network Address`,
'sf866305516492af0': `Interface`,
'se1b13a7c92d4dcc3': `Connection Type`,
's89d11288ef7198fa': `This network has no gateway.`,
'sff9aad8a96d11e8c': `Mac Address of Sender:`,
'sd9f73b49c90cb730': `IP Address of Sender:`,
's228664e90e9a6cec': `Mac Address of Receiver:`,
's8b0705a2df382b10': `IP Address of Receiver:`,
's9739ed2dd4a000eb': `Add/ Configure graph components`,
's953fefbfaf0e2e3d': `CIDR/ Subnetting`,
'sbd62973250ca30ae': `Packet travelling simulation`,
's492ae98a6cd1ae70': `How to add a physical node (host, router, switch,...)?`,
'sd9994f251f1280cf': `Step`,
's6debdd8a9764e3fc': `Choose your component`,
's0e98fa123505c680': `More details with "Add details for ports"`,
's3356cd0d48121928': `Pick a color also if you want to:`,
's78ab938d4d37d39c': `Click add`,
's4c51e3cba34af73d': `How to add a logical node (network node)?`,
's47707a379c47dc00': `Configure your network`,
's55759c57f408a4bd': `How to add a link between two physical nodes?`,
's87dd4e7f900ee9ea': `Choose edge component`,
's2c35f5501ffe52a0': `Toggle draw mode`,
's95bd2e0d6d483b0d': `Draw then configure on right click`,
's01743e321d86591f': `Activate the "assign gateway" mode:`,
's57df860deb5b4777': `Drag the gateway on the edge of a network:`,
's181fd03f13912ebc': `How to drag a component into a network?`,
'sf226fb633985e8b4': `Activate the "drag-and-drop" mode:`,
'sb2d67306c97f577a': `Drag the component inside the network:`,
'se965fe13b9222a65': `How does the Net-based mode work?`,
's768df033dc306fbc': `Before dragging a node into network`,
's05c0bb42cb996b2d': `After dragging the node into network`,
's6e5cadbf42d9dfe4': `New IPv4 will be assigned for conflicting addresses.`,
'sa165462237196374': `During this mode, when users edit addresses of:`,
's5eab6ee6f2de2dc9': `conflicting addresses of all related hosts/gateways will be reassigned.`,
'sf3b70df62ae36483': `new addresses will be validated against the network addresses and will only be accepted when they are valid.`,
'sdf132350672d0884': `How does the Host-based mode work?`,
'sc2227119cd519b57': `Before dragging host0 into network`,
's50edcfd6439c5398': `After dragging host0 into network`,
's3d312902efb57145': `The existing network will expand to contain the new host.`,
's8709fa6bb7aa0002': `networks`,
's2906cb2c9daacae3': `new network address range will be checked if they expands the old ones.`,
's3ec4a053318b0ae8': `hosts/gateways/subnetworks`,
'sb6017dbf0932fc3d': `the existing network will expand to contain the new addresses.`,
'se911c0eb6fe86b71': `How to manipulate a simulation session?`,
'sd17ec63289209641': `if you don't use a graph from the examples, Init a new simulation session`,
'sb25dcf3e6fa2992a': `In this step, for the:`,
'sa2885d6d322c7379': `host/router: ARP table and routing table are created`,
's30c43f21d5cc55e7': `switch/bridge/access point: MAC address table is created`,
's10a895b419c64000': `assign a sender/receiver for the packet`,
'se2d49a99d6a83255': `Click on Choose sender or Choose receiver`,
'sff73ed19941a31e1': `Click on a host on the canvas`,
'sef49669556fd05dc': `Choose an IP`,
'sb3e91073b21ceb33': `start sending a packet with the assigned sender and receiver in step 2`,
's33541b5c2b2dff1a': `Repeat steps 2 and 3 as much as desired.<br/> You can also use pause/resume or change focus/speed during or before starting to send a packet.`,
's19db88ac376ff979': `Last step`,
's0106a71d5407aaa9': `Stop session`,
's9d1892a929c95c41': `resets all tables and ends the current simulation session.`,
'sbf424bf9f5374d3f': `Start from step 1 again for a new simulation session.`,
'safb8ca5860037ac7': `How to configure the tables?`,
'sfa22b4f47f6a0daa': `Init. Ignore this step if you use an example graph, or there is a session running`,
's5beb40a454294a7e': `Click on Add to generate a new row in the table`,
's347e78eb6a59dd4f': `Fill your table according to its type. Except for the tables of the routers, tables of other nodes can be filled automatically.`,
's1bce63088d7fcd55': `Remove button removes all checked rows`,
's7f9f4694cf4a1ee3': `Save button saves the current table on the UI to the database`,
's870a89403be74609': `is out of available ports.`,
's0b0811fac0075534': `Your table is saved!`,
's9c84598a99c03b88': `Bitmask`,
'sbcc845948d536d4e': `ARP Table`,
'sc86686973428936d': `Routing Table`,
's47f47667e50169dc': `Mac Address Table`,
'sf9aee319a006c9b4': `Add`,
'sea4f08110bb8f15d': `Remove`,
's33f85f24c0f5f008': `Save`,
's652d3637d25431f5': `Your receiver has received the message!`,
's7f03c3305cc572c7': `Currently the widget only supports host as sender and receiver.`,
'sa1e005e5c8a7cf53': `Please Init a session before simulating sending a packet.`,
's8c139c7e7f2a7866': `Your graph is not qualified for this feature:`,
'sfc2940e33d865b93': `Please use the Check button of the Subnetting/CIDR feature for more details`,
's0a1356ab500a1312': `The sender or receiver is not selected yet, use the Choose sender/receiver button then click on the graph node.`,
'sedb7e84739dabb52': `The widget currently only support sending Parcel between layer 3 components`,
's2e55a928208bdb7f': `Your packet finished sending with the loop-back address.`,
'sba272ff6dce6bf6c': `An exercise for CIDR from classful networks: drag and drop then check.`,
'sf5a28de7d04f6bf1': `An exercise for CIDR from classful networks: configure the classful networks then check.`,
'se6394d8e29dba878': `An exercise for subnetting from a classful network: configure the subnets then check.`,
's0be43d4fa79554a1': `A mixed exercise of CIDR and subnetting: drag and drop then check.`,
'sc12a027fbcfb0c9b': `Ethernet with a repeater and 2 hosts.`,
'scc2c5dc40950c43d': `Ethernet with a hub and 3 hosts.`,
's73b5a4a416157778': `Ethernet with a bridge and 2 hosts.`,
'sdbdba9594afe53ce': `Ethernet with a switch and 3 hosts.`,
's370a2d0578bd2c7b': `Wifi network with 1 access point, 3 hosts.`,
's2f615aee386409b0': `2 Ethernets with a gateway.`,
'sb1463e72905de3f8': `An ethernet, a wireless network and a gateway.`,
's22feccbbd1ae2aa8': `3 Ethernets and a gateway.`,
's18662a2a14477a6f': `2 Ethernets and 3 routers.`,
's8c8aeec90bdad274': `2 Ethernets and 4 routers.`,
's1f7698c061c208c9': `Open`,
's7eb13b92e2f5090f': `Example exercises for CIDR/ Subnetting`,
'sb8766aae5913b0ef': `Example networks for simulations`,
's6f1b8c80ab2b4fd4': `Tip: Use the CIDR/Subnetting controller to drag-and-drop then check.`,
's6ea934c6536e4930': `Right-click on each network, then select Edit details to change its configuration.`,
'scfdc7642367b9665': `Tip: Set source and destination then click on play button in`,
'sbfe6d7af32c6737d': `Packet sending controller to start simulation`,
'sef49aec68fd1dc66': `Name`,
's46e517b2962de3ce': `Change Port Config`,
'sbc909ebb8c28f954': `Default Gateway`,
'sdff41263f305c0ea': `Define Interfaces`,
's82f9a9addfd569b4': `Define Network`,
'sf2811f9a2c3aecfb': `Details of the ports `,
's4114a8a9e84611a4': `No port available.`,
'sf35d6a5dc03d5557': `Add Port`,
's5d754d60e804c665': `Details of the connection between `,
's3c0a015edb522c38': ` and `,
'sa4b72835cba0d053': `Source Port`,
'sc9e9b70c7d6caa43': `Target Port`,
's9a66f95d51e77c3d': `Details of the network `,
's71183ed55882f1c9': `IPv4 address is invalid.`,
's5882939b7613896e': `Invalid net id.`,
'sf2fe311e301fa69b': `Network Mask`,
's02ba6f5ad4b7f7d3': `Invalid netmask.`,
's146232d3025412f3': `Invalid bitmask.`,
's0ccb657bb5ab7aef': `MAC address is invalid.`,
'sb3db490afc111f9f': `IPv6 address is invalid.`,
's331ff328f4efcdce': `Arp Table`,
's13a56952f9635fe4': `Set Source`,
'se340f70c28bb766c': `Set Target`,
's479cdff9480652de': `Start Simulation`,
's64ef2a6c2dd1d3d1': `Edit`,
'scfcffcf35292bc6f': `Simulate`,
'sd03c537f123f42a6': `Exit Fullscreen`,
's4b10acae683d2978': `Fullscreen`,
's5eedf01beec54734': `Tutorials`,
'sba1e8892999bb878': `Computer`,
's4f0026a488fbdca3': `Mobile device`,
'sd8dddc9cd2d5b135': `Network device`,
'se51d6fb9158b9f24': `Router`,
's265dbd543be2f5ed': `Access point`,
's491d2a19cd6ec58c': `Hub`,
's8e114dd98aeedf91': `Switch`,
's6503256c2de2745c': `Edge`,
'sf4c791f0705344d6': `Network assignment`,
'sf0751c039d26da12': `Gateway assignment`,
's0201d8d614a1b5a4': `Validate global address assignments`,
's9c0c880f87b91eb4': `Import a file created by this widget`,
's04507e583f35a215': `Export the current graph`,
's8ccfa5f804f6777a': `Example graphs/exercises`,
's7c31cf556c31642f': `Tutorials for features of this widget`,
'sabab0da440471b2c': `Physical Node`,
'sf70e0979427bcaf8': `Logical Node`,
'sbe1c7d207f771f2d': `Number of ports`,
's94c954118f54fa1d': `Number of input ports`,
'sd9d1a55c5a664641': `Add details for ports`,
's79ca6e84a4df82e5': `NetID`,
's0b985047f07efbd0': `Netmask`,
'see822b9851671c85': `Click to add your component`,
'scf4ac84fce176d91': `Click to draw connecting links`,
's08cf63ff39d4bfaf': `Click to change color of existing components`,
's2ffac3a7ddd1580b': `CIDR/Subnetting controller`,
's82dba63ce339e3a6': `Choose a mode`,
's22b5492cdee5c0d6': `Manual Mode`,
'sf0453217220f9a2d': `Net-based Mode`,
's7bc931f3ffdb6e60': `Host-based Mode`,
's73c3e21df2f12350': `Activate Draw-and-drop`,
's7a3fb8031d3600cb': `Drag to assign gateway`,
's42cbd8dca939a9c7': `Check`,
'sfd468f7c41396df5': `Packet sending controller`,
's0dcc53abaa5c5df9': `Choose sender`,
's0356c70f23c234fd': `Choose receiver`,
'se24130f1123560a0': `Speed`,
'sd8fe5e97ed28d99c': `Focus on animated nodes`,
's62278f512692e037': `Session`,
's1951d0ebc9976aaf': `Create a new simulation session`,
's649522600e4a80ac': `Start sending a new packet`,
'se4752f0e82f9a5ab': `Pause/resume all packets`,
's840bfacd9e8e393d': `Stop the simulation session`,
'sce83fe4fe279ab21': `Track tables`,
};